Job Summary
Senior Software Engineer to build the PSA Liquidity Platform, a product suite that connects supply and demand across our marketplace (PSA Partner Offers and the eBay Consignment platform). You will own the technical design and delivery of end-to-end buyer and seller experiences, build a next-generation buyer platform with targeting and analytics, develop a real-time matching engine, design scalable microservices and event-driven architectures, and drive cross-functional execution with product, design, data, and engineering teams. The role emphasizes AI-first development, end-to-end ownership, and collaboration to maximize GMV, conversion, and offer-to-sale velocity while ensuring a high-quality, observable production system. You will contribute across the stack (frontend, backend, infrastructure, and data) and participate in strategy-to-execution planning, stakeholder alignment, and delivering measurable impact in a fast-moving environment.
Required Qualifications
- 6+ years of engineering experience
- Track record of designing, shipping, and scaling 0-to-1 products with measurable business impact
- Strong proficiency in Java (Spring Boot) and modern frontend frameworks (React and Svelte) with fluency across the stack
- Experience designing and operating distributed systems including microservices and Kafka-based event-driven architectures; familiarity with Kubernetes and AWS
- Observability mindset with experience building dashboards and using monitoring tools (Datadog, New Relic, OpenTelemetry)
- Experience working on AI-first initiatives and applying AI tooling across the SDLC
- Strong written and verbal communication; ability to align engineers, product partners, and stakeholders
- Ownership mindset and ability to handle end-to-end ownership across frontend, backend, infrastructure, and data
- Ability to operate in a fast-moving, self-directed environment
- Bonus: passion for collecting and domain knowledge of the collectibles market
